1. An antenna member comprising a first coil and a second coil which have a rotational symmetry to each other, and
wherein the first coil includes a first supply terminal applied with a current and a first ground terminal connected to the ground, the second coil includes a second supply terminal applied with the current and a second ground terminal connected to the ground, and
wherein the first coil and the second coil each include a first portion having an arc-shape and a second portion having an arc-shape which as a whole form one winding,
when seen from a side, the second portion has a relatively lower height than the first portion,
the second portion of the second coil is positioned below the first portion of the first coil, and the second portion of the first coil is positioned below the first portion of the second coil, and
wherein a central angle of the first portion and the second portion is 180°.

10. A substrate treating apparatus comprising:
a chamber providing a treating space;
a chuck member provided at the treating space and supporting a substrate;
a window positioned above the chuck member; and
an antenna member positioned above the window, and
wherein the antenna member includes a first coil and a second coil which have a rotational symmetry to each other, and
wherein the first coil includes a first supply terminal applied with a current and a first ground terminal connected to the ground, the second coil includes a second supply terminal applied with the current and a second ground terminal connected to the ground, and
wherein the first coil and the second coil each include a first portion having an arc-shape and a second portion having an arc-shape which as a whole form one winding,
when seen from a side, the second portion has a relatively lower height than the first portion,
the second portion of the second coil is positioned below the first portion of the first coil, and the second portion of the first coil is positioned below the first portion of the second coil, and
wherein a central angle of the first portion and the second portion is 180°.
